Reports of NSA removal sparks momentum for MP Amritpal's party, massive gathering in Sahnewal
Babushahi Bureau
Chandigarh, March 16, 2025 – The removal of the National Security Act (NSA) from seven Sikhs of Punjab, previously lodged in Dibrugarh jail, and their transfer to Punjab jails has reignited political momentum for MP Amritpal’s party.
In response to the development, a massive gathering was organized in Sahnewal this afternoon.Among the key attendees were Amritpal’s father, Tarsem Singh, and Faridkot MP Sarabjit Singh Khalsa.
The meeting is believed to have focused on significant political and strategic discussions, signaling a renewed push for the party’s agenda.
